🌿 Why Essential Oils in Laundry?
Essential oils do way more than smell good. A few drops can kill odors, add natural freshness, and turn your laundry into an aromatherapy moment. No fake “fresh linen” scent required.
Try lavender for calm, lemon for clean vibes, or peppermint if you want that crisp, just-showered feeling on your sheets. Bonus points: no mystery coating left behind.
🧺 Here’s What You’ll Need
Grab 3 – 6 wool dryer balls (they last forever), your fave essential oil, and if you’re feeling fancy, toss in a little white vinegar during the rinse cycle for natural fabric softening. Want to skip dryer balls? A square of cotton cloth with a few oil drops works too.

🌀 How to Use It
Drop 3–5 drops of essential oil onto one dryer ball before each load. Let it soak in for a minute so it doesn’t transfer oil onto fabric. Toss the ball into the dryer and let it work its magic.
For extra softness, splash a bit of white vinegar into your washer’s rinse compartment. It helps fluff towels and reduce static – no bottled softener needed.
